Smoke reported at three-story building in Berlin borough, Berlin NJ
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.
Fire responders were called to a three-story wood-frame building near Washington Avenue in Berlin Borough after smoke was reported in the living room. Upon arrival, no active fire was found. The alarm was triggered by a workman on site.
